I will say Dumb ass and smart ass are different, at least in UK English. A Dumb ass is someone who has said something really stupid, mainly getting common knowledge wrong. A Smart ass is someone who corrects someone's mistakes and is smug about it, in general anyway.

If you want something that doesn't make sense, go with flammable/inflammable. They both mean the same thing despite the fact if a word usually has an in- in front of it, then it means the opposite.

Then refers to a prediod of time.
Than refers to someone or something in comparison.

Simple enough.
